I have a 2004 1.6 Sport Hatch, I drove home last nite, parked the garage at home, locked it by pushing the lock button twice, and this morning nothing! The car will not unlock with the remote, so i manually unlocked it with the passenger door lock. When inside the internal lights wont come on, but the radio will, so i doubt its the battery. Also the security light in the speedo is solid red instead of its normal flashing. The engine wont start, the deadlocks are stuck on, and there is no warning or greeting message flashing up. Anyone else experienced this problem or any ideas as to what it could be???

Cheers,


PS. I have replaced the key card battery and tried jump starting the car, neither worked.

I hope it is the battery as it's an easy fix. Somehow, I'm not sure. If you connected jump leads to a good engine and had the same problems, I would be concerned. Perhaps the terminals are loose? Hope I'm wrong. Have you checked the big fuses on the battery positive terminal?

It was a fuse on the battery that had blown!
the repair guy took off the fuse and said the car is grand to drive for the future but get a new fuse at some point.
